    Just to make the math harder with a pass you also get a 25% discount at most places which is ~ equal to the $20 discount. It always seems to work out that if you ski one place more than 14-15 times a pass is the way to go even if like to wander. Less than that get a card or cards.

    Quote Originally Posted by mntlion View Post
    http://skilouise.com/louise_cards.php
    "Take advantage of 3 free days on your first, fourth, and seventh visits.

    4 Top Resorts
    Take your free days at Lake Louise, Kicking Horse, Castle, or Revelstoke. Plus get $20 off full-day regular ticket price, during all other visits at any of the four resorts."

    Card is $100, then days 2,3,5,6 are all $80-20 = $60, and 1,4,7 are free. $100+(60*4) = $340/7 = $48.50 a day, so if you ski 7+ days you are cheaper then last years $50/day. PLus you have deals at other hills too.
